Recycling photovoltaic panels has some major benefits. For beginners, it helps reduce the quantity of waste that is being sent out to land fills or burners. Not only does this advantage the atmosphere by decreasing air pollution, however it can also conserve cash in disposal costs in addition to important resources such as steels or glass. Furthermore, reusing photovoltaic panels enables materials that were as soon as taken into consideration unusable to be repurposed right into brand-new items. Recycled products can additionally be made use of to generate less expensive variations of brand-new solar panels, making them more obtainable for individuals that might not have actually had the ability to manage them previously.
The downside of reusing photovoltaic panels is that there is usually a lack of facilities in position for correctly taking care of old ones. Sometimes, this means that unsafe products are released right into the environment during manufacturing or disassembly procedures which can cause health and wellness threats for those living nearby. Additionally, recyclers may not always be able to recoup all elements from taken apart panels as a result of their age or condition which can lead to further environmental concerns because of incorrect disposal methods.

2. Obstacles Of Recycling Solar Panels
It is commonly approved that reusing photovoltaic panels has several environmental advantages, nonetheless, it is additionally true that the process isn't without its challenges. But just what are these difficulties? Allow's investigate additionally.
Among the greatest concerns with recycling photovoltaic panels is the intricacy of the task itself. It can be hard to break down the various components, such as glass and steel, to be reused individually. In addition, photovoltaic panel manufacturers frequently have a mix of products used in their items that makes sorting them even more complicated. Additionally, there are security and wellness risks involved with managing busted glass or breathing in fumes from melting parts.
An additional vital challenge related to reusing photovoltaic panels is cost. Many countries do not have sufficient framework or resources to adequately recycle these things which leads to greater expenses for organizations trying to do so. Moreover, due to the specialized nature of reusing solar panels, this can create a financial worry on companies attempting to stay certified with guidelines. Eventually, these prices could be passed down to customers making it difficult for them to pay for renewable energy sources.
